Output 3ecefb2db71fb16d3b4887ff17b4a938be3c9d885e9d2ab8c091b11ae472208f:0

value
3107134052758
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 677b3df81e6a6c8f8becce6dac6c4895e624cf79 OP_EQUALVERIFY OP_CHECKSIG
address
DEaFn2TTosW6qPVpK5Ft55LR6XgiZT6hHD
transaction
3ecefb2db71fb16d3b4887ff17b4a938be3c9d885e9d2ab8c091b11ae472208f